OS and Hardware Requirements It’s helpful to know what you can install before we compare everything, so let’s do that: Docker for Mac Docker for Mac requires that you’re running Yosemite 10.10.3+ or newer but it’s worth mentioning that you should upgrade to 10.11+ because 10.10.x releases are considered “use at your own risk”. You CAN run VirtualBox alongside Docker for Mac as long you’re using a somewhat new version of VirtualBox. All of the 5.x releases are ok. This is pretty useful because you might have some legacy apps running in Vagrant / VirtualBox to deal with (I know I do!). Docker for Windows Docker for Windows requires that you’re running Windows Pro, Enterprise, or Education edition. Sorry, Home edition isn’t available and that’s because Microsoft doesn’t currently allow Hyper-V to be installed on Home editions. Also, unlike Docker for Mac, you cannot run any version of VirtualBox, VMWare or any other Type 2 hypervisor along with Docker for Windows. That’s because Docker for Windows uses Hyper-V under the hood which is a Type 1 hypervisor. Docker Toolbox If you can’t run Docker for Mac or Docker for Windows then there’s the Docker Toolbox. As long as you can run VirtualBox then you’re good to go (Docker Toolbox manages this for you). It works all the way back to MacOS 10.8 and Windows 7 (yep, even Home editions). Your own Virtual Machine Docker will happily run inside of VirtualBox, VMWare or any other Type 1 / 2 Hypervisor that’s running a major distribution of Linux. Pros and Cons Now for the good stuff! Docker for Mac / Docker for Windows Pros • Offers the most “native” experience, you can easily use any terminal you you want since Docker is effectively running on localhost from MacOS / Windows’ POV. • Docker is heavily developing and polishing this solution. Cons • On Windows, if you have legacy apps that need a VM, you can’t reasonably do both. • On Windows, volume mount performance is still quite poor, but it’ll improve in due time.
